What was your life like before you started the program?
I was stuck in a cycle of grief and food was my best friend. I had a lot of losses over the last couple of years and I took those losses to food. I wasn't investing positive things in my life, I had unhealthy patterns, I wasn't taking care of myself, and I wasn't exercising. I wasn't dealing with the underlying things to break free.
How did you find Elizabeth and why did you choose her?
I found Elizabeth's podcast and started listening to it. I wanted to be thoughtful and intentional and investigate someone that had a similar mindset to mine, and I felt like Elizabeth did. I took my time before I really decided to do the coaching.
What was your experience with GLP-1 medications in the program?
She doesn't shove GLP-1 down your throat, which I appreciate. She doesn't put you on it right away. She made me lose weight on my own so that I could see I could do it on my own. As time went on, it felt like a secondary piece; the primary work was really in my heart.
How did this compare to previous weight loss attempts like Optavia?
I tried Optavia and I didn't do well on it. It's soy-based and I missed real food. It didn't feel sustainable or like real life, and it didn't address the underlying things. It was just me using it as a control mechanism to try and lose a few pounds.
When did you start noticing results and what were they?
I noticed probably a month in that things started to shift. Mindsets and habits started to shift. Logging food wasn't something I dreaded; it was something I saw value in. The heart changes really came the last two months, diving into the larger stories at play to make food secondary and the rest of my life primary again.
What surprised you most about the coaching process?
What surprised me the most was the deeper things she was able to help me process and work through. I was surprised by how effective she is at drawing you out to heal what needs healed. I knew those things were there, but I wasn't anticipating the level of healing that took place in just three months.
How do you feel now that you have completed the program?
I really feel like I'm on a good foundation. I'm pursuing things that I love again, and I have balance with food again. I feel joy in my life that I didn't have before. My food noise is hardly there, and when it is, I have the tools to talk back in a healthy way. I'm more peaceful and I manage it; it doesn't manage me.
